Chesapeake proves there’s no barrier to innovation
C
hesapeake is currently developing a number of speciality barrier coatings that offer moisture vapour, flavour and grease proof properties. These
barrier coatings, which can be applied to a range of packaging formats, are being developed by Chesapeake’s Research & Development team. They aim to provide improved performance over existing solutions and more environmentally considerate options. Improved grease barriers are being demanded by food producers especially for dried pet-foods which often have oil content in excess of 10%. Traditionally, a substantial layer of plastic has been applied to cartonboard to facilitate its use in many barrier applications but both brand owners and consumers are now seeking more environmentally considerate solutions. Chesapeake is developing a technique to apply a special grease-resistant coating to the reverse of a range of cartonboard types. The technique allows the application of coatings that are not typically applied at the board mill during production. For more information visit
